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
Cut the chicken breast into bite-sized pieces and season lightly with salt and black pepper.
Add chicken to the pot and cook until browned on all sides, about 5 minutes. Remove the chicken from the pot and set aside.
In the same pot, add the diced onion and minced garlic. Sauté until the onion is translucent, about 3 minutes.
Add the sliced carrot, celery, and diced bell pepper. Cook for another 4-5 minutes until the vegetables start to soften.
Stir in the zucchini slices and halved cherry tomatoes. Cook for 2 more minutes.
Pour in the chicken broth, add the bay leaf, thyme, and oregano. Stir well.
Return the chicken to the pot. Bring the stew to a gentle simmer, cover, and cook for 20 minutes.
Remove the bay leaf. Stir in the kalamata olives and heavy cream. Cook for an additional 5 minutes.
Add the fresh spinach and stir until wilted.
Finish with a squeeze of lemon juice,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
Serve the stew hot, ideally with a side of whole grain bread or quinoa.
